Sampling

The Fantom-XR lets you sample audio sources, such as an audio
device, mic, or CD.
This section explains the sampling procedure and what the
parameters do.
Switching external input
on/off
1.
Press INPUT knob.

2.
To turn it off, press INPUT knob again.

Making Input Source Settings
(MIX IN)
1.
Connect the input device whose sound you will sample
(e.g., CD player or mic) to the INPUT jacks or to the DIGITAL
IN connector located on the rear panel of the Fantom-XR.
Cautions when using a microphone
Howling could be produced depending on the location of
microphones relative to speakers. This can be remedied by:
1.
Changing the orientation of the microphone(s).
2.
Relocating microphone(s) at a greater distance from
speakers.
3.
Lowering volume levels.
2.
Press [SHIFT] so it lights, and then press the INPUT knob.
The MixIn/InputFX Switch screen will appear.

3.
Press [ENTER].
The Input Setting Menu screen will appear.
4.
Select MIX IN (Mix In).
fig.14-002
5.
Press [ENTER].
The Mix In screen will appear.
Alternatively, you can access the Mix In screen by choosing
"Mix In" from the MixIn/InputFX Switch screen menu, and
pressing [ENTER].

• Digital Input Level
If you've set Input Select to DIGITAL IN, this adjusts the input
level from the DIGITAL IN connector.
Value:0–127
7.
Play back the external input source.
8.
If you use INPUT jacks, turn the INPUT knob to adjust the
volume.
* If you're using DIGITAL IN, this adjustment is not necessary.
983
* If the volume of the external source is too high, the PEAK indicator
will light. If this occurs, turn down the LEVEL knob until the PEAK
indicator no longer lights.
9.
Press [EXIT] to return to the previous screen.
